Joint Aid Management is a non-profit Christian humanitarian relief organisation founded in 1984.
JAM currently assists more than 340,000 children with feeding programmes in Angola, Mozambique, Rwanda, South Africa, Sudan & Benin. JAM has offices in Canada, UK, Germany, Norway & the USA with the headoffice in Johannesburg.

FEEDING
JAM's nutritional feeding programmes are mainly focused on schools, with the main objective to assist malnourished children to attend school and further their education while receiving good nutritional intake.
WATER DRILLING
JAM Drilling has responded to the great need for clean and safe water in South Africa in the areas of Limpopo, Eastern Cape, KwaZulu Natal and Mpumalanga. Drilling operations are also underway in Southern Sudan. The main focus is to supply portable water to desperate communities, close to a local school or community centre, where possible. JAM has supplied more than 700 boreholes since drilling operations started in 2001 and is planning to start water provision operations in Mozambique and Benin within the course of the year.
AGRICULTURAL ASSISTANCE
JAM provides seeds, tools and agricultural training for rural communities in the countries where they operate, enabling families to help themselves.
RWANDA
Due to the genocide in Rwanda, more than 95,000 children were orphaned by the end of 1994. JAM established an orphanage in Giterama, Rwanda. This orphanage houses as many as 800 children. These orphans receive nourishment from 3 healthy meals each day as well as loving care given by staff and teachers employed at the orphanage. JAM also sponsors schooling for each child with a strong focus on education.
At the JAM training centre, young men and women receive practical skills training in art, domestic science, carpentry, pottery, computer literacy and agriculture. The Rwandan Department of Education has approved the courses offered and each graduate receives a certificate. A school for the deaf is also included in the JAM Training Centre.
SOUTH AFRICA
Community and school upliftment programmes in the Orange Farm area of South Africa include:
1. A training centre to train HIV/AIDS representatives as well as offering agriculture, computer sciences and other skills development courses 2. Sports facilities for schools and the community 3. A multimedia centre, including a community internet café
JAM is implementing a schools gardening project for 10 schools in South Africa's Eastern Cape, providing seeds, tools and a borehole at each school. Scholars will also receive training in agriculture, sanitation, nutrition and general health.
